IosCameraOptions constructor
const
IosCameraOptions({
- NativeCameraLens lens = NativeCameraLens.defaultLens,
- NativeCameraFps fps = NativeCameraFps.platformDefault,
- IosCameraSessionPreset sessionPreset = IosCameraSessionPreset.high,
- bool enableVideoStabilization = true,
- NativeImageFormat imageFormat = NativeImageFormat.heic,
- NativeVideoCodec videoCodec = NativeVideoCodec.hevc,
- int? videoBitrate,
- NativeVisionPerformanceMode visionPerformanceMode = NativeVisionPerformanceMode.balanced,
- Map<
String, Object> manualControls = const <String, Object>{},
Creates iOS camera customization options.
Implementation
const IosCameraOptions({
this.lens = NativeCameraLens.defaultLens,
this.fps = NativeCameraFps.platformDefault,
this.sessionPreset = IosCameraSessionPreset.high,
this.enableVideoStabilization = true,
this.imageFormat = NativeImageFormat.heic,
this.videoCodec = NativeVideoCodec.hevc,
this.videoBitrate,
this.visionPerformanceMode = NativeVisionPerformanceMode.balanced,
this.manualControls = const <String, Object>{},
});